Ethereum’s rise in market value signifies a growing acceptance of digital assets among institutional players. This shift is fueled by significant spot ETF inflows, reflecting increased investor confidence.
Ethereum’s market cap ascended past $416 billion, overtaking the likes of Johnson & Johnson, underscoring investor confidence. This transition into the top 30 global assets highlights increased acceptance of digital currencies. Key figures like Vitalik Buterin and the Ethereum Foundation continue to advocate for its adoption.
Market Impact and Growth
Raoul Pal, CEO of Real Vision, stated: “Ethereum is the platform where the value layer of the internet is being built,” which is echoed by recent market milestones.
Multiple US-listed spot Ethereum ETFs experienced substantial inflows, with $726 million in a single day signaling strong institutional demand. Vitalik Buterin remains a pivotal figure, and his contributions are crucial to Ethereum’s continued resilience and growth.
The cryptocurrency’s surge impacts DeFi tokens and layer 2 solutions positively. Institutional steam propels Ethereum to new heights, affecting associated assets as well. The market’s reaction reflects broader acceptance of digital assets.
